The Solution: Comparing Stretch Wrapping and Shrink Wrapping
Stretch Wrapping: A Flexible and Cost-Effective Option
Stretch Wrapping involves wrapping a pallet with a highly elastic film that stretches around the load, securing it in place 🔄. This method is renowned for its flexibility, as it can accommodate oddly shaped or sized pallets with ease 📏. When comparing Stretch Wrapping vs Shrink Wrapping for industrial pallets, Stretch Wrapping often emerges as the more cost-effective option, requiring less material and energy to apply 💸. However, its performance can be compromised if the film is not applied correctly or if the load is particularly heavy 🚧.
Shrink Wrapping: A Tight and Durable Solution
Shrink Wrapping, on the other hand, uses a film that is applied loosely around the pallet and then shrunk tightly using heat 🔥. This method provides a durable and tamper-evident seal, making it ideal for high-value or sensitive products 🚫. When assessing the best Shrink Wrapping for industrial pallets, consider the type of product being shipped, as Shrink Wrapping can provide superior protection against environmental factors and theft 🌟. However, it requires more energy and material than Stretch Wrapping, increasing costs and environmental impact 🌎.
Use Cases: Choosing the Right Wrapping Method
When deciding between Stretch Wrapping and Shrink Wrapping for industrial pallets, consider the specific needs of your operation 📊. For example:
- **Lightweight and Regularly Shaped Pallets**: Stretch Wrapping is often the preferred choice for its cost-effectiveness and ease of application 📈.
- **Heavy, Irregular, or High-Value Pallets**: Shrink Wrapping provides the necessary durability and security, justifying the additional costs and environmental considerations 🚀.
- **Pallets Exposed to Harsh Environments**: Shrink Wrapping’s tight seal offers better protection against dust, moisture, and extreme temperatures ❄️.
